Show filters
Sort by

Don’t leave so soon. You can test our service for

Start now
4.50/5
21 reviews from 2 sources
1061 N Shepard Street, Unit K, Anaheim
3.67/5
6 reviews from 2 sources
219 N. EUCLID WAY, Anaheim
MAP LIST